The Current State of Late Night
Late-night television has always been a battleground for comedians, with each host vying for the attention of a dwindling audience.
In an era where streaming services and social media dominate entertainment consumption, traditional late-night shows face unprecedented challenges.
Colbert, the host of “The Late Show,” has managed to carve out a niche for himself with his sharp political satire and engaging interviews.
Meanwhile, Kimmel, known for his playful antics and celebrity interviews, has maintained a loyal following despite the competition.
However, as both shows continue to navigate these turbulent waters, the question remains: can they adapt to the changing tides of viewer preferences?
The Colbert-Kimmel Dynamic
The dynamic between Colbert and Kimmel has always been intriguing.
Both share a mutual respect for each other’s work, yet their styles are distinctively different.
Colbert’s approach often leans towards the intellectual, using wit and humor to dissect current events.
Kimmel, on the other hand, embraces a more laid-back, relatable style, often incorporating sketches and viral videos into his repertoire.
